Isiah Thomas likes how the New York Knicks have positioned themselves in free agency.
Thomas, the Knicks' former president of basketball operations, told SNY's Ian Begley on May 15 New York's cap space should give them plenty of leverage during the offseason.
They're positioned well for free agency because they have cap space and they can go out and pitch themselves.
They're positioned to have a great summer. But it depends on luck. If they're lucky enough, it can become a great summer.

The Knicks own the third overall pick of the 2019 NBA Draft. With that in mind, the chances of drafting coveted Duke Blue Devils forward Zion Williamson is extremely low (the New Orleans have the No. 1 overall pick).
Begley then asked Thomas about his thoughts on New York selecting Williamson's Duke teammate, R.J. Barrett. Thomas believes Barrett is “one of the top-rated players in the country over the last four or five years.” Barrett should exploit his talents in head coach David Fizdale's system.

Thomas also told SNY the Golden State Warriors' Kevin Durant is “the best player in the game right now.” Thomas didn't delve into the Knicks getting Durant. All he said was Durant will make a profound impact on whatever team he joins this summer.
In the event the Knicks snag both Barrett and Durant, they will become a better team. They should improve on their lowly 17-win season in 2018-19. Will they become a playoff team with those two on board? Probably not.
However, that's a solid long-term foundation to build on.
